The Muskegon Community College softball team has kicked off the season on a southern trip.
Through the Lady Jayhawks’ first four games, they are 2-2.
 Northeast Mississippi 7, Muskegon CC 2 (6 innings): On Friday, Alyssa Telling had one hit to lead MCC, which led 1-0 after the top of the first inning. Northeast Mississippi answered with two runs in the first and four more in the fourth, thanks to a pair of solo home runs.
Muskegon CC 10, Lincoln Land CC 0 (5 innings): On Saturday, a seven-run fourth inning carried MCC to the victory. The Jayhawks were led by Kim Burleson, who had two hits, drove in a run and scored two. She singled in both the third and fourth innings.  Kaytlin Woziak  allowed one hit, no earned runs and allowed no walks in three innings of work. Taylor Sanicki added an RBI double for the Jayhawks.
Three Rivers CC 7, Muskegon CC 6 (6 innings): Also on Saturday, MCC fell a run short against Three Rivers. Sydney Tharp  had a pair of singles to lead MCC.
Muskegon CC 6, Northwest Mississippi 1 (6 innings): Kelly Barnes had two hits to spark the Lady Jayhawks. Among her hits was a sixth-inning double that plated two runs. Pitcher Megan VanderWal pitched four innings and allowed two hits, no earned runs, two walks and she struck out three. Sanicki had an RBI single.
